And one of the most popular areas for Botox treatment is around the eyes. So how much Botox do you actually need when dealing with areas around the eyes? In cases of treating eye problems, the average dose is 12 to 24 total Botox units, with forehead lines requiring 20 units and crow's feet requiring 24 units.

How many units of Botox needed for under eye?

1) Under-Eye Area

Results from these procedures suggest about 8 Botox units will be enough to reduce the appearance of under-eye wrinkles and even bagginess.

How much Botox for eye wrinkles?

The Guide to Botox

According to Allergan's guide, it is twelve units for the crow's feet or wrinkles around the eyes to get the desired result. That means 24 total units because we have two eyes.

How many units of Botox is needed for 11 lines?

Answer: Botox Units for 11s and Frown Lines

The standard FDA approved dosage of Botox into the 11s area is 20 units; however, every patient is different and will require different treatment regimens. Some will need less and some will need more. Botox temporarily stops muscles from contracting.

Where should you not inject Botox around your eyes?

A qualified, experienced injector should never inject the area near the orbital bone right above the pupil. If Botox is injected here, it can drift down toward the upper eyelid and cause an eyelid droop. This can last from weeks to even months.

Will 2 units of Botox do anything?

The amount of Botox needed to improve crow's feet depends on each individual. An optimal dose should last 3 to 4 months. Two units per side is a very low dose and typically would last about 2 to 3 months. You will need to wait and see what dosage will work for you and give longevity.

How long does it take to see results of Botox under the eyes?

It typically takes about 3 days for noticeable results, when the muscles around your eyes begin to relax. Injections for this small area generally need to be repeated every 3 to 4 months.

Is 40 units of Botox a lot?

For horizontal forehead lines, practitioners can inject up to 15–30 units of Botox. For “11” lines between the eyes (or glabellar lines), up to 40 units are indicated, with higher doses needed in male patients .

Why do I still have 11 lines after Botox?

It sounds like the muscle has been knocked out with the dose you received. It will take many weeks or even months for the crease to smooth out and it is important to keep up with the Botox to keep those muscles knocked out or they will once again work on the overlying skin to reform the wrinkles.

Why do I still have wrinkles after Botox?

Botox can not fill out very deep wrinkles, and will likely not smooth them out completely. In order to completely eradicate deeper lines, you may want to look into filler, or other facial treatments, such as non surgical facelifts, face lifts, thread lifts, and other treatments available.

Does Botox take longer to work on deeper wrinkles?

“For example, patients will generally see results more quickly in areas such as the corners of the eyes (crow's feet) and fine forehead lines,” he said. However, Trujillo says the results may take longer for areas where the lines are deep or etched.

How do you fix jelly rolls under your eyes?

Fine lines and the muscular ridge beneath the eyes are known as a jelly roll. They become prominent when you laugh or smile, making your eyes look puffy and exhausted. A carefully injected neurotoxin under the lash line can help you achieve a smoother and less puffy under-eye area. Botox and Dysport are great options.
